EDF ENERGY – UK Underground Gas Storage

EDFE

Energy and Power is acting as Owner’s Engineer for this EDF Energy salt cavern gas storage project in Cheshire. Energy and Power is defining the engineering design limits and criteria within which the detail design is developed, monitoring the detail design, co-ordinating technical matters with drilling contractors and managing the overall delivery of the gas storage and treatment facilities.

SABIC –A1 Horizontal Directional Drilling

SABIC

Energy and Power were contracted to provide multi discipline engineering including pipeline and HDD expertise from FEED through to construction and installation of a new section of the Trans Pennine Ethylene Pipeline (TPEP), providing project selection and project execution services.
